Description

Offered to the market for the first time in over 100 years, along with No Onward Chain, we are pleased to present this detached Victorian cottage full of charm and history. Built in 1870 and set in the heart of Kibworth, the property was once known locally as “The Telephone House” in the 1920s when it housed the village’s first telephone exchange.

The property already benefits from UPVC windows and gas central heating and offers the next owner a fantastic opportunity to modernise this characterful property to make their own with a light programme of refurbishment.

From the entrance hallway, the living room sits to one side with a coal effect gas fire set into a decorative surround and built-in shelving. On the opposite side is a dining room with exposed beams, fitted cupboards and a further coal effect fire within brick surround. The kitchen is fitted with a range of units, oven, fridge and plenty of worktop surface space. This space leads through to a small utility space which provides a rear entrance hallway. Completing the ground floor is currently the bathroom though as mentioned later in the particulars, this could easily be moved upstairs and then this room could be an additonal space to the kitchen, or separate study for example.

Upstairs the accommodation offers three bedrooms currently, two being doubles and the third a single. The two doubles are very comfortable sizes for a property of this overall size and style and therefore it seems very viable to easily locate a new bathroom in what is currently the third bedroom, especially that this space is directly above the kitchen.

Externally, to the rear of the property there is a private, sunny courtyard garden with space for outdoor seating, perfect for entertaining! A side passageway leads through gated access on to the garden.

Kibworth remains one of the area’s most desirable villages, with an excellent range of amenities including pubs, restaurants, shops, coffee houses and sports clubs covering golf, cricket, tennis and football. The village is surrounded by beautiful South Leicestershire countryside, while London can be reached by train in just an hour from nearby market town of Market Harborough, making it a convenient location as well as a picturesque one. A rare chance to own a property with great potential in the heart of this popular village.
